View Java Class Source Code in JAR file
- Download JD-GUI to open JAR file and explore Java source code file (.class .java)
- Click menu "File → Open File..." or just drag-and-drop the JAR file in the JD-GUI window jcommondomain-core-1.2.2.jar file.
Once you open a JAR file, all the java classes in the JAR file will be displayed.
org.jeecqrs.common.event
├─ org.jeecqrs.common.event.AbstractEvent.class - [JAR]
├─ org.jeecqrs.common.event.DefaultEventId.class - [JAR]
├─ org.jeecqrs.common.event.Event.class - [JAR]
├─ org.jeecqrs.common.event.EventBus.class - [JAR]
org.jeecqrs.common
├─ org.jeecqrs.common.AbstractId.class - [JAR]
├─ org.jeecqrs.common.AbstractIdentifiable.class - [JAR]
├─ org.jeecqrs.common.CompareById.class - [JAR]
├─ org.jeecqrs.common.CompareByValue.class - [JAR]
├─ org.jeecqrs.common.Identifiable.class - [JAR]
├─ org.jeecqrs.common.Identity.class - [JAR]
org.jeecqrs.common.domain.model
├─ org.jeecqrs.common.domain.model.AbstractAggregateRoot.class - [JAR]
├─ org.jeecqrs.common.domain.model.AbstractDomainEvent.class - [JAR]
├─ org.jeecqrs.common.domain.model.AbstractEntity.class - [JAR]
├─ org.jeecqrs.common.domain.model.AbstractEventSourcedAggregateRoot.class - [JAR]
├─ org.jeecqrs.common.domain.model.AbstractValueObject.class - [JAR]
├─ org.jeecqrs.common.domain.model.AggregateRoot.class - [JAR]
├─ org.jeecqrs.common.domain.model.DomainEvent.class - [JAR]
├─ org.jeecqrs.common.domain.model.Entity.class - [JAR]
├─ org.jeecqrs.common.domain.model.Repository.class - [JAR]
├─ org.jeecqrs.common.domain.model.ValueObject.class - [JAR]
org.jeecqrs.common.event.sourcing
├─ org.jeecqrs.common.event.sourcing.EventSourcingBus.class - [JAR]
├─ org.jeecqrs.common.event.sourcing.EventSourcingUtil.class - [JAR]
├─ org.jeecqrs.common.event.sourcing.Load.class - [JAR]
├─ org.jeecqrs.common.event.sourcing.Store.class - [JAR]
├─ org.jeecqrs.common.event.sourcing.Version.class - [JAR]
org.jeecqrs.common.event.routing.convention
├─ org.jeecqrs.common.event.routing.convention.ConventionEventRouter.class - [JAR]
org.jeecqrs.common.sagas
├─ org.jeecqrs.common.sagas.AbstractEventSourcedSaga.class - [JAR]
├─ org.jeecqrs.common.sagas.AbstractSaga.class - [JAR]
├─ org.jeecqrs.common.sagas.SagaCommandBus.class - [JAR]
├─ org.jeecqrs.common.sagas.SagaTimeoutProvider.class - [JAR]
org.jeecqrs.common.commands
├─ org.jeecqrs.common.commands.AbstractCommand.class - [JAR]
├─ org.jeecqrs.common.commands.Command.class - [JAR]
├─ org.jeecqrs.common.commands.CommandBus.class - [JAR]
├─ org.jeecqrs.common.commands.DefaultCommandId.class - [JAR]
org.jeecqrs.common.event.routing
├─ org.jeecqrs.common.event.routing.EndpointNotFoundException.class - [JAR]
├─ org.jeecqrs.common.event.routing.EventRouteEndpoint.class - [JAR]
├─ org.jeecqrs.common.event.routing.EventRouter.class - [JAR]
├─ org.jeecqrs.common.event.routing.InvokeMethodEndpoint.class - [JAR]
org.jeecqrs.common.util
├─ org.jeecqrs.common.util.ReflectionUtils.class - [JAR]
├─ org.jeecqrs.common.util.Validate.class - [JAR]
org.jeecqrs.common.persistence.es
├─ org.jeecqrs.common.persistence.es.AbstractEventSourcingRepository.class - [JAR]
├─ org.jeecqrs.common.persistence.es.AnnotationEventStreamNameGenerator.class - [JAR]
├─ org.jeecqrs.common.persistence.es.CanonicalNameEventStreamNameGenerator.class - [JAR]
├─ org.jeecqrs.common.persistence.es.EventStreamName.class - [JAR]
├─ org.jeecqrs.common.persistence.es.EventStreamNameGenerator.class - [JAR]